The official list of ICAO identifiers is published by the ICAO in document 7910. This document is available from the ICAO at the following address or by calling 514-954-8219 (voice) or 514-954-6077(fax):

This page provides a means to find the physical information associated with an observing station by entering either a WMO numeric index number or ICAO four-character alphanumeric. The information provided includes the station identifiers, name, country, WMO region, station latitude and longitude, and elevation.
